Components of the Invention:

  1. Data Acquisition Module: Sources linguistic data from diverse resources, enhancing the AI’s exposure to various languages, time periods, and disciplines.
  2. Etymology Analysis Module: Deciphers the historical development of words, identifying roots, cognates, and borrowings to construct a word’s full semantic spectrum.
  3. Nomenclature Analysis Module: Analyzes terminology systems in different fields, unraveling the conventions and meanings behind specialized terms.
  4. Contextual Understanding Module: Synthesizes etymological and nomenclatural insights within specific contexts, refining the AI’s interpretative accuracy.
  5. Language Generation Module: Employs the AI’s enriched understanding to generate contextually and historically informed language outputs.
